Foundation Overview
Based in Boston, MA, Beech Tree Trust has awarded 21 grants totaling $553,505 to organizations in Massachusetts, Rhode Island and 2 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$5,000 to $85,562, with a median award of $17,755.

Geographic Focus
76% of all grants are concentrated in Massachusetts, demonstrating highly focused geographic giving. This foundation prioritizes deep community impact in its primary service area. Within Massachusetts, funding concentrates in New Bedford (44%), Barnstable (31%), Boston (19%).

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
